And with Joan and Dick romancing through the pic- ture and Glenda falling in love with Moore—whom she had set out to “take over”—there’s plenty of love interest, Safety Conference Is Planned by Aviators Washington, Dec. 31.—()—Federal authorities, acting in the wake of four major crashes this month, joined hands with airline operators Wednes- day in an effort to reduce eirplane accidents. The commerce department made plans for a safety conference between transport operators and Spokesmen for the army, navy, coast guard and national advisory commit- tee for aeronautics. A date will be fixed soon. Great Northern Has Refunding Proposal Washington, Dec. 31. — (#) — The Great Northern Railway company asked the Interstate Commerce com- mission Wednesday for authority to issue and sell $50,000,000 of general mortgage 3% per cent bonds. The sale is in connection with a pro- gram to refund or pay at maturity, ® portion of its outstanding indebt- edness, MECHANIC FOUND DEAD Rogers, N.
